Summary
Responsibilities include, but are not limited to, proper accounting for all financial activity of the college in an effective and efficient manner to ensure compliance with all accounting practices and financial reporting requirements and guidelines, and all federal and state reporting requirements. Responsible for the coordination and compliance for the various audits of the College. Provides information to assist the administration in decision-making process and the effective allocation and use of college resources, and assist faculty and staff in understanding the financial operation of the college. Additional areas of responsibility may include, accounts payable, payroll, accounts receivable, grants accounting, purchasing, and coordination of external audits. The Controller will participate as a member of the college leadership team. The Controller is directly responsible to the Vice President for Finance and Administrative Services.
